Oddworld: Soulstorm is the explosive second game in a brand new Oddworld Quintology that tells the continuing story of Abe and his comrades as they discover further crimes against Mudokonkind and look for the spark that will ignite a revolution.

Oddworld: Soulstorm Enhanced Edition is a action, adventure and action-adventure game developed and published by Oddworld Inhabitants.
Released on June 21st 2022 is available only on Windows in 12 languages: English, French, Italian, German, Spanish - Spain, Czech, Polish, Portuguese - Portugal, Russian, Simplified Chinese, Spanish - Latin America and Traditional Chinese.

It has received 549 reviews of which 367 were positive and 182 were negative resulting in a rating of 6.4 out of 10. 😐

The game is currently priced at 31.99€ on Steam.

System requirements

These are the minimum specifications needed to play the game. For the best experience, we recommend that you verify them.

Windows
  • Requires a 64-bit processor and operating system
  • OS: Windows 10
  • Processor: Intel Core i5 4460 or equivalent
  • Graphics: nVidia GeForce GTX 970 or equivalent
  • DirectX: Version 11
  • Additional Notes: While development is ongoing, all above specs are subject to change.

I am a big fan of the Oddworld series, it was my childhood game ever since Abe's Oddysee, but something about this game just didn't fit right from the previous games they did. First of all the graphics are amazing, along side with the cutscenes from it, I can tell there was a lot of effort placed in those and I cannot lie it was really great seeing this improvement, the map design was also well made and felt more alive than before and the story wasn't something I expected, but it wasn't too bad in the end. For the gameplay perspective I feel mixed feeling about it, the movement is pretty good, the fact that you can double jump and you're able to dodge some bullets and environment is nice, you're more mobile than before. I do dislike the commands when you talk to the mudokons, From 9 different options you remain with only two, the option to say "Hi" and to "Follow", the Passive/Aggressive ones I never used because I felt no difference in it. Also in this topic whenever you walk or run while some mudokons are nearby and call them, some will stand there like they didn't heard you, or when they follow you some of them are very slow and don't move at the same time with the others and are left behind either to get crushed or killed. The mechanic of giving them something to throw isn't the greatest, it feels a bit buggy and sometimes they take too long to throw objects or throw too many. This is mostly on levels where you have to rescue the mudokons from the background and you have to protect then while they climb which it was the most infuriating thing I found in the whole game and that is when I gave up on making good Quama. The different mudokons like in Exoddus, the blind ones, angry, sad, drunk, etc. those were such great mechanics that I liked a lot, but they weren't there, I know they did say that this is not an Exoddus remake but I thought they could add some features from it since it was one of the best games they made. The crafting in this game is something new and never expected it, sometimes I was not using it unless the game required you to, you can have different play styles with each throwable the game offers you but you end up limited on what you can use, I don't know why we can't carry everything we get on every level, it makes no sense to me when you enter a new level and all of you inventory will be empty and throw away the moolah Abe gets, but the keys are permanent? Why would Abe get rid of the stuff he got in the previous section, not to mention that you will use some items once or twice in the whole game, then you won't find them ever. About the badges, they aren't really important to me, I never paid any attention to it but it make it much easier to know if there are more mudokons to rescue or if there are secret areas in that level, other than that I never was interested in them. On to some levels that I found interesting but felt a bit disappointed because they weren't longer. The Sanctum was something I expected and didn't at the same time, the Sleeches are a much more improved and difficult type of fleeches, which were in the previous games as well, but they didn't felt as dangerous as before since you can keep a torch lit and run in them, you'll never get touched. The Sanctum was something I would expect from the Oddworld series, something like a temple it is a must have in every game they did, it was very short but still fun, but I thought I'd see some Scrabs and Paramites they were in every game and not seeing them in here felt off, I really wanted to be chased by a Scrab or to possess a Paramite to talk to my other Paramite brothers but no, they were scraped in this game. There were more variations of the Sligs with different arsenals or even armor, something I didn't expect, and the Slogs were ok too, but that was pretty much it. The Glukkons that were introduced I thought it was going to be like in Abe's Exoddus or Munch's Oddysee were you control them but no, they aren't there, only in the cutscenes. Overall, the game wanted to be something new and more advanced than the previous games, I cannot say I'd recommend this or not I have mixed feelings about it, I really did try to enjoy this game since is my favorite series but I couldn't wait to end it already, somehow I got the bad ending and couldn't play the last 2 levels, but I don't think I'll try it again.
